Cheryl McClure reserves a room at the Hampton Inn in Asheville, N.C., and is offered an $81-a-night rate. Then the hotel has second thoughts and changes the rate to $149 a night. Can it do that? And what, if anything, does a “confirmed” rate mean? Should McClure cancel her hotel stay, or can the Hampton Inn be persuaded to honor its first rate?
